Genesis 11

From verse 18, there's a list of names... again. But, the first part of the chapter was pretty interesting. I remember learning about this chapter in Grade 5-ish, and finding the answer to how we came to have different languages.

In verse 4, it says, "...let us build ourselves a city, with a tower that reaches to the heavens, so that we may make a name for ourselves...". Clearly, God created different languages because of the corruption in Babel. It sounds really harsh, but I think that God initially made the whole world with one language so that we can be unified as one and do God's will as one. But, clearly, the people of Babel took advantage of the fact that everyone understood each other, and wanted to accomplish different things together, for themselves; they were being selfish.

So, they basically used the blessing from God for their selfish wants. As much as I think that those people were stupid and ignorant, I must admit that I've been in their shoes. Often, when God gives us something great in our lives, we use it for personal gain. For example, some people might have really good social skills, and they could use them to approach people and introduce them to God. However, they might choose to use their social skills to make lots of "cool" friends.. (don't know if that's the greatest example, but hopefully you get my point).

Anyway, in the time of thanksgiving, I hope that we can count all of the blessings and gifts from God, and figure out ways to use them in order to bring glory to God.

Genesis 11

I've always really liked the story of the tower of Babel. I always found it so fascinating because I find the idea of languages pretty interesting. The world currently has about 6,700 existing different languages, and this is where it all began. Prior to this, everyone spoke the same tongue. That's really hard to fathom.

v.6 The LORD said, "If as one people speaking the same language they have begun to do this, then nothing they plan to do will be impossible for them."

Verse 6 made me a little bit sad because it implies the greatness that could have been achieved when all could understand one another. Instead, we let our sinful natures get ahead of us and the division of tongues was 'necessary' in God's eyes...Not gonna lie, I'm pretty curious as to what could have been...
I liked what Dennis wrote about how people took advantage of the gift of a unified tongue. Along the same lines as she wrote of, it made me question how often I take what God has blessed me with, and in failing to recognize what great potential He's granted me, I choose to build my own Babel instead. Where in my life have I been shunning God and building impossible towers? In light of thanksgiving, I wanna challenge us to think of these areas in our life and recommit them to God. Also, I think it's always good to keep yourself in check, because it isn't uncommon for God to sometimes bring tribulations your way for the sake of humbling and helping you along your way of recognizing where He's working in your life.
